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led and motivated Public Relations Officer to join our team. As a Public Relations Officer, you will be responsible for managing and enhancing the public image and reputation of our organization. You will develop and execute effective communication strategies, build relationships with key stakeholders, and handle media relations. The ideal candidate has exceptional communication skills, a strong understanding of public relations principles, and the ability to adapt to a fast-paced and dynamic environment.

Responsibilities

  • Communication Strategy: Develop and implement comprehensive communication strategies that align with the organization's goals and objectives. Create messaging frameworks, key talking points, and press releases to effectively convey the organization's mission, initiatives, and achievements.
  • Media Relations: Cultivate and maintain relationships with media representatives, journalists, and influencers. Proactively pitch stories and secure media coverage for the organization and its events, campaigns, and milestones. Serve as the primary point of contact for media inquiries and coordinate interviews and press conferences.
  • Content Creation: Write, edit, and distribute compelling and engaging content for various channels, including press releases, newsletters, articles, blog posts, and social media. Ensure all content is accurate, consistent, and aligned with the organization's brand and messaging.
  • Crisis Management: Act as the organization's spokesperson during times of crisis or reputation management issues. Develop crisis communication plans, prepare key messaging, and manage media inquiries effectively. Mitigate potential damage to the organization's reputation and maintain transparency and trust with stakeholders.
  • Stakeholder Engagement: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including clients, partners, government agencies, and community organizations. Develop communication materials tailored to specific audiences and collaborate with internal teams to ensure consistent messaging across all touchpoints.
  • Event Planning and Management: Coordinate and oversee the planning and execution of press conferences, product launches, corporate events, and other public relations initiatives. Work closely with event organizers, vendors, and internal teams to ensure seamless execution and maximum media exposure.
  • Monitoring and Reporting: Monitor media coverage and public sentiment related to the organization and its industry. Prepare regular reports on media activity, campaign effectiveness, and key performance indicators. Analyze data to identify trends, opportunities, and areas for improvement.
